Care about making sure everyone has enough to eat in our community? The Greenfield Public Library, in collaboration with the Franklin County Hunger Task Force, will host the “Hunger Action Month Traveling Show”, beginning Saturday, September 24 through Friday, September 30, as part of National Hunger Action Month. There will be six posters on the Library grounds highlighting information about hunger in our community. Each poster will explore a different issue related to hunger, and feature easy ways to help end hunger in our community, including QR code links that can be read by smartphones. The Franklin County Hunger Task Force, as part of National Hunger Action Month, organized the Hunger Action Traveling Show. The FC Hunger Task Force is a program of Community Action Pioneer Valley. The Task Force includes community members and staff, volunteers, and guests from Franklin County’s food access programs. This program is free and open to the public.

“Necessary brattiness” is the motto for Speedy Ortiz’s dauntless new collection of songs, Twerp Verse. The follow-up to 2015’s Foil Deer, the band’s latest indie rock missive is prompted by a tidal wave of voices, no longer silent on the hurt they’ve endured from society’s margins. But like many of these truth-tellers, songwriter, guitarist and singer Sadie Dupuis scales the careful line between what she calls being “outrageous and practical” in order to be heard at all. “You need to employ a self-preservational sense of humor to speak truth in an increasingly baffling world,” says Dupuis. “I call it a ‘twerp verse’ when a musician guests on a track and says something totally outlandish – like a Lil Wayne verse – but it becomes the most crucial part.
